Prince Harry and Meghan Markle’s Christmas Plans Unveiled After Royal Family Snub: Celebrate the Holidays with the Sussexes

Prince Harry and Meghan Markle’s Christmas Plans Unveiled After Royal Family Snub: Celebrate the Holidays with the Sussexes

November 24, 2024 Catherine Williams Entertainment

Prince Harry and Meghan Markle will spend Christmas at their Montecito home. They did not receive an invitation from the Royal family for their annual gathering at Sandringham. Instead, the couple will celebrate with their children, Prince Archie and Princess Lilibet, along with Meghan’s mother, Doria.

Sources report that Harry and Meghan turned down an invitation to celebrate with Princess Diana’s family, the Spencers, at Althorp. A source indicated this could be their last Christmas at home, making it extra special. They plan to create a joyful day for their children, despite the absence of extended family.
